Cannot run SAP after license is installed -- somebody help ......

Former Member
0 Kudos

We just installed license in SAP B.One server. After installation, the 30-day limit is removed. However, after installed the license, we cannot run any modules e.g. Purchased Order, Invoice, etc....

When we click

Click Purchase Order we get message:

"You are not licensed to open form [142] Invoice"

Click Sales Order we get message:

"You are not licensed to open form [139] Invoice"

Upon boot up, I see in the bottom screen some sort of error message, but it went so fast and I cannot read it. I believed it is something like "You are not licensed to open..."

1. What is happening and how to solve this?

2. Supposed it were working; How long will the license expire? Is there any "never-expired license" in SAP B1?

Hi Tom,

1.make sure your license file has been imported properly (ServiceManager will say so)

2.in business one, login as manager

3.go to Administration->License->License Administration

4.select "manager" in the left panel, tick checkbox of "Professional User"

5.click the "Main Menu" to make it active

6. select menu->tools->form setting, click "Apply Authorization"

here you go
